COOPERSTOWN - The Otsego-Schoharie District Annual Investiture Service was held at Bump Tavern, on Wednesday May 17th, located in the Farmers Museum in Cooperstown.

This service is performed by the Past Masters from many of the Lodges within our district to newly elected Masters before they can be installed in their respective Lodges.

R:. W:. Edward Gilbert, Deputy Grand Master of the Grand Lodge of the State Of  New York was our guest of honor for the evening.

Bump Tavern was originally located in Windham N.Y.  Because of its prominence as an historical meeting place it was moved, board-by-board, and rebuilt at its present location at the Museum in Cooperstown.
